Output 671fc98950693ec6ab85f82cc1ece19ddb503b15ebeebb4b2a56c0a97b620ae7:0

value
10073230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1223fcf3e0763cb01594f2c5738eecf2cd53926 OP_EQUAL
address
3NDQzPKVhAjoBtpeGMTi3kYA4UELbQb4mL
transaction
671fc98950693ec6ab85f82cc1ece19ddb503b15ebeebb4b2a56c0a97b620ae7
spent
true